Actually two of the days we went there, the park hit capacity pretty early on.   I was super glad for the opportunity to test the new Magic Bands - which also gave us the ability to FastPass items from home before we even left.  Only 3 FastPasses per day but hey it was wonderful!   We also learned that we could still do FastPasses with our cards as well. SCORE!

Our cute Magic Bands..
So the Magic Band thing is pretty cool if you haven't had a chance to try it out yet (still in testing phase).  Basically your band is your key to the world.  It gets you into the room, pays for your dinner, gets you into the park, does your fast passes.
